Output ed908162793fccc62e20c25fd6e521954fb40c223028556f064232c286a2efd5:93

value
161006
script pubkey
OP_0 OP_PUSHBYTES_20 687df7d2b2768ec276e73795a76938adc6e8da97
address
bc1qdp7l054jw68vyah8x726w6fc4hrw3k5hf73qk9
transaction
ed908162793fccc62e20c25fd6e521954fb40c223028556f064232c286a2efd5